passable
Universal Words
adjective
1 fairly good but not excellent
SYNSATISFACTORY:
She put on a passable imitation of a Scottish accent. * He served a bottle of very passable claret with the meal.
2 [notusuallybeforenoun] if a road or a river is passable, it is not blocked and you can travel along or across it:
The mountain roads are not passable until late spring.
OPPIMPASSABLE
